Gardens Illustrated  |  September 2020
Segue gently into autumn with the help of Gardens Illustrated and its list of 56 plants for later days colour. There’s a host of beautiful anemones alongside jewel-like perennials from Elizabeth MacGregor Nursery and Keith Wiley’s plants of the month. Be inspired by the garden Dan Pearson created for Tokachi Millennium Forest along with a garden from Emma Burrill which combines a Modernist layout with prairie planting. Plus read designer Andy Sturgeon on the gentle interventions gardeners can make to restore order and witness Ula Maria’s design for a small city garden in east London.
